The USDA-ARS Northern Great Plains Research Laboratory (NGPRL) in Mandan, ND seeks a Postdoctoral Research Associate (Ecologist/Soil Scientist) for a two-year appointment. The incumbent will join a multidisciplinary team conducting research to determine ecosystem services derived from contrasting agricultural practices throughout the US, and will work with team members to generate and integrate soil-, water-, plant-, and economic-based data from on-going experiments conducted at NGPRL and Long-term Agroecosystem Research sites across the US. Experimentation will be at the plot and field scale, including select on-farm sites. Effective writing and analytical laboratory skills are required. Ability to work as a collaborative team member is essential. Proficiency in statistical analysis is highly desirable along with research experience spanning multiple agroecosystems. A Ph.D. is required, and salary is commensurate with experience plus benefits. Citizenship restrictions apply.
